Business Operations

National Beverage Corp. functions as a holding company for its subsidiaries, focusing on the marketing, manufacturing, and distribution of a diverse array of beverage products. The company’s extensive product portfolio includes multi-flavored and cola soft drinks, juice and juice products, flavored carbonated and spring water products, and various specialty items.
